Kambo is an ancient healing practice used by the indigenous people of South America for thousands of years. Kambo also known as ‘Sapo’ is an Amazonian tree frog, that lives primarily in the tall trees of the amazon rainforest. The relationship between the tribe’s people and Kambo is truly unique. Sharman’s will sing special songs calling up to the tree frogs. The tree frogs will then jump down to greet the shamans and they are harvested safely. The frogs are usually suspended by four sticks which enables the shamans to extract the medicine secretion. The secretion is what we as practitioners use during a Kambo treatment. No frogs are harmed during this process and they are released back to the forest. This special relationship between nature and humans is truly amazing.
Kambo Treatment - What Happens?
Kambo is a powerful and natural healing treatment assisting to purify and cleanse the cells of toxins and stagnant residual energy within the physical body. Kambo works both physically and spiritually releasing, unblocking and clearing the body from trapped emotions, trauma, pain or negative energies. During the serving of the Kambo medicine Steven or Chris will burn various gates on either the arm (males) or the leg (females). Kambo is applied to superficial burns ( Gates) on the skin. A small stick is made red hot and just the top layer of skin is removed the size of a dot, creating what we call a gate . You then to drink 1-2 litres of water during a period of 20 minutes. The water acts itself like a medicine helping to purge and clear the body from toxins during the purging. The Kambo is then applied onto the gate and absorbed into the body. The medicine is placed on different gate points allowing it to work through the lymphatic system, entering into every cell of the body. It is aimed that during the purge, clients are able to safely release and let go. Most clients will experience the purging process in different ways either by: being sick, excessive sweating, bowel movements, crying, or having to go to the toilet. This will slowly pass once the medicine has worked through the body. Kambo has no known detrimental side effects and is perfectly safe or those that are not
contraindicated. There are the health conditions/health issues which people would not be a fit for, here is the list:
– Aneurysm
– Active ulcers.
– Alcohol Dependence
– Addison’s Disease.
– Brain issues (any)
– Blood Clots.
– Chemotherapy or Chemo Drugs 6 Weeks Post.
– Drug dependency (all opioids + benzos)
– Diarrhoea that has lasted for several days (due to electrolyte imbalance)
– Gastric Sleeve or band
– Heart issues (any)
-Organ transplant
– PTSD (must only be treated by advanced Practitioners only)
– Bipolar, schizophrenia, schizo affective disorders, psychosis, personality disorders.
– Previous psychiatric history must be declared.
– Medicated low blood pressure
– Recent Surgeries – Min 8 Weeks Post.
– Stroke.
– Pregnant.
– Pancreatic issues
– Breastfeeding – Under 6 Months.
– Within 21 days of giving birth.
– Under 18 years of age.
– Asthmatic – depending on severity – Must bring an inhaler.
– Diabetics need to bring insulin, testing strips, and food.
– Anybody that has taken Buffo for 8 weeks prior
– COVID Vaccination (min 6 Weeks post)
– Water fasting & fasting 48 hours prior, a meal is recommended the day before Kambo.
– The use of distilled water, enemas, colonics, saunas of sweat lodges 48 hours prior
most medications and supplements are fine with Kambo and the medication can be skipped on the morning of Kambo, e.g. antidepressants can be skipped on the morning of treatment and
taken afterwards.
Individuals taking the following classes of medication are contraindicated for Kambo:
– Antipsychotics
– Antiepileptics
– Antidiuretics (suitable for Kambo 5 days after this medication has been ceased)
– Diuretics
– In the case of Alcohol dependency the client must be fully withdrawn for a minimum of 2 weeks prior to treatment.
– Antibiotics are best to be taken alone without Kambo. Kambo can then be taken after the course of antibiotics has been finished.
– In the case where Benzodiazepines are used regularly or dependently, the individual must be fully withdrawn from the medication under the guidance of a health professional for a minimum of 4 weeks prior to the treatment.
– All Opioid dependency or Opiates taken daily will need to be stopped entirely for a min of 2
weeks (codeine, tramadol, morphine, OxyContin, fentanyl, buprenorphine, methadone, heroin).
– Please refrain from alcohol or recreational drug use for at least a minimum of 48 hours prior to Kambo treatment.
Kambo is a very physical experience which involves a feeling of heat in the body usually followed by vomiting and sometimes evacuating from the intestines as the body purges toxins from the various organs. The mind is often made quite clear and focused and some say they receive specific messages. Kambo works mostly to purge the body of toxins and what is called “panema” or a heaviness, dullness of body and spirit. The experience with Kambo is very much like getting sick and the energetic and health benefits that many report usually come in the days and weeks that follow.
